Transaction 309173009f33c657fa4cd24e325e6e8b2156e55b0cdac144dfa292311c923016
1 Input
1 Output
-
309173009f33c657fa4cd24e325e6e8b2156e55b0cdac144dfa292311c923016:0
- value
- 890421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0fd7ae2e54232e705b463e2c9378086905554ee OP_EQUAL
- address
- 3GNFhLXauDwqPr9SkcQfF1h2wYYhBadn26